>>Sorry but it took me quite a while programming in foxpro again. I'm working with two maximized forms. I have a button in form1 with do form2. In form2 I have another button that releases it. So, how can I go back again to form1?
>
>* button1
>do form2 with thisform
>
>*form2.init
>lparameters oCaller
>this.addproperty("oCaller",m.oCaller)
>
>*form2 button
>with thisform
>if type(".oCaller") = "O" and ;
> Isnull(.oCaller) and ;
> lower(.oCaller.Baseclass) == "form"
> .oCaller.Show()
>endif
>.release()
>endwith
>
Cetin

Should you set oCaller property to NULL in form 2 Destroy?
